Table 2 Prevalence of virulence genes from 125 S. aureus isolates

From: Characterization of Staphylococcus aureus isolated from patients with burns in a regional burn center, Southeastern China

Genes

Total (n = 125)

SSTI (n = 75)

non SSTI (n = 50)

P value

lukS/F-PV

19

15

4

0.112

sea

16

3

13

0.002

seb

19

16

3

0.042

sec

3

3

0

0.161

sed

5

2

3

0.372

see

1

1

0

0.415

seg

54

21

33

0.009

seh

1

0

1

0.223

sei

29

19

10

0.583

sej

6

3

3

0.626

tst

7

5

2

0.547

HLa

118

72

46

0.871

HLb

59

38

21

0.567

HLd

99

62

37

0.689

HLg

118

73

45

0.766

  1. SSTI, skin and soft tissue infection; lukS/F-PV, gene encoding Panton-Valentine leukocidin; sea-see and seg-sej, gene encoding staphylococcal enterotoxins; tst, gene encoding toxic shock syndrome toxin 1; HLa- HLg, gene encoding staphylococcal hemolysin. P-value and two-sided P-value were calculated by the chi-square or Fisher’s exact test appropriately
